/> There's something about Dino Morea. He's a survivor. In spite of two resounding flops Bhram and Anamika in a row he continues to forge a craggy path in his career.

Now after much delay he's ready to produce his own film where, naturally enough he'll cast himself in the lead. And the much hot-and-sought after Kareena Kapoor will play Dino's female lead.

The actor smarting under the double blow at the boxoffice is playing it cautious. "It's an adaptation of a very successful play from the UK. At this 'stage' I'd rather not say more because someone is always there to pull the rug from under your feet."

Last year Dino had signed Shamim Desai to direct his first feature film but was left and and dry by Desai.

Now Dino is shy. Prod him a bit more, and Dino (never very good with secrets) blurts out, "The hit play in the UK was directed by a very talented guy called Pravesh Kumar, and now I've hired him to direct my first feature film based on his own play."

The film will be based on one of Pravesh's two hit plays Deranged Marriage or Something About Simi. Dino and Kareena bonded beautifully when they shot the paint ad in Rajasthan with Karan Johar last year.

"Karan played the lead with Kareena while I was just the silent producer. I made her promise that if and when I produce a film she'd have to be my co-star. I never knew the director for my first feature film would have the same idea."

But why Kareena and not Dino's close friend Lara Dutta?

Dino explains, "Kareena suits the role perfectly. It's almost as if the role was conceived for her. She's meant to play the part. In fact the play is named after her character."

This sounds like an instant replay of Saif's first production where the director chose Deepika Padukone over Kareena because the former suited the role.

For the time being Dino has decided to cut loose from all outside assignments.

"For many years I've done films to earn money so I could buy my car house and a life in Mumbai. Now I need to build a body of work, and just my body, " Dino quips.

He has only one film on the floors. "In Acid Factory producer Sanjay Gupta and director Suparn Varma have given me a completely new look. I haven't ever grown my hair to shoulder-length. I better do it now or soon it'd be too late." Dino's co-stars in Acid Factory are Aftab Shivdasani, Fardeen Khan, Manoj Bajpai and Danny Denzongpa.

"I'm working with Danny and Manoj for the first time and what an experience! I yearn to learn from actors who know more than me. We bond really well. We have to. Because we're all supposed to be locked up in this factory from which we cannot escape."

After a moment Dino adds, "Fortunately there's an escape route to my career.Making my own films."
